Compartilhar via


Método CustomXMLParts.Add (Office)

Permite que você adicione um novo CustomXMLPart a um arquivo.

Sintaxe

expressão. Adicionar (XML, SchemaCollection)

Expressão Uma expressão que retorna um objeto CustomXMLParts .

Parâmetros

Nome Obrigatório/Opcional Tipo de dados Descrição
XML Opcional String Contém o XML a ser adicionado ao recém-criado CustomXMLPart.
SchemaCollection Opcional CustomXMLSchemaCollection Representa o conjunto de esquemas usado para validar este fluxo.

Valor de retorno

CustomXMLPart

Exemplo

O exemplo a seguir adiciona um novo CustomXMLPart, seleciona um CustomXMLPart usando um critério de pesquisa e seleciona um único nó dessa parte.

Sub ShowCustomXmlParts() 
    On Error GoTo Err 
 
    Dim cxp1 As CustomXMLPart 
 
    Dim cxn As CustomXMLNode 
    Dim cxns As CustomXMLNodes 
    Dim strXml As String 
    Dim strUri As String 
 
        ' Example written for Word. 
 
        ' Add a custom XML part. 
        ActiveDocument.CustomXMLParts.Add "<custXMLPart />" 
 
        ' Returns the first custom XML part with the given root namespace. 
        Set cxp1 = ActiveDocument.CustomXMLParts("urn:invoice:namespace")         
 
        ' Get a node using XPath.                              
        Set cxn = cxp1.SelectSingleNode("//*[@quantity < 4]")  
     
    Exit Sub 
                 
' Exception handling. Show the message and resume. 
Err: 
        MsgBox (Err.Description) 
        Resume Next 
End Sub

Confira também

Suporte e comentários

Tem dúvidas ou quer enviar comentários sobre o VBA para Office ou sobre esta documentação? Confira Suporte e comentários sobre o VBA para Office a fim de obter orientação sobre as maneiras pelas quais você pode receber suporte e fornecer comentários.